WebFeb 24, 2014 · We start hiking through farmland. It is a steep, steady climb for about 45 minutes.The path is clear, but our breath tightens as we take in the mountain air. Once we reach the park boundary, we scale a stone wall and the real adventure begins. We are in a bamboo rainforest, minutes from the gorillas. WebDian Fossey was escorted by Alan Root to D.R. Congo where she obtained a permit, she required to visit gorillas in the Virunga Mountains. He hired 2 men to work with her at the camp plus porters to assist carry her luggage and gear to the Kabara meadow. Root helped Fossey set up a camp and briefed her about gorilla trekking/tracking.
